We want to use the PowerApps (V2) trigger because it supports files as an input type whereas the PowerApps trigger does not. Can you please share the error message you are receiving? For the ID, select the ID from the When an item is created context in the Dynamic Content Window. Please see, Make A Flow To Upload Documents To A SharePoint Library, Connect The 'Upload To SharePoint' Flow In Power Apps, Upload Multiple Files To A SharePoint Document Library, Add Metadata To A SharePoint Document Library, 7 Mistakes To Avoid When Creating A Power Platform Environment, Power Apps Filter Multiple Person Column (No Delegation Warning), SharePoint Delegation Cheat Sheet For Power Apps, Youtube Video: Search Power Apps With No Delegation Warnings, Power Apps: Search A SharePoint List (No Delegation Warning), https://powerusers.microsoft.com/t5/Building-Power-Apps/Possible-to-clear-attachments-when-editing-a-form/td-p/648621, https://powerusers.microsoft.com/t5/Building-Power-Apps/How-can-we-reset-the-attachment-field/td-p/136245, How To Make A Power Apps Auto-Width Label, Power Apps Curved Header UI Design For Mobile Apps, All Power Apps Date & Time Functions (With Examples), 7 Ways To Use The PATCH Function In Power Apps (Cheat Sheet), Easiest Way To Generate A PDF In Power Apps (No HTML), 3 Ways To Filter A Power Apps Gallery By The Current User, 2023 Power Apps Coding Standards For Canvas Apps, Create Power Apps Collections Over 2000 Rows With These 4 Tricks. A file must be passed as an object to Power Automate. Go to the data tab on the left menu and add any existing SharePoint list from your SharePoint site. Thanks for the answer Matthew. I come from a SharePoint centric background so I've built a lot of SharePoint Designer Workflows in my day. But it is ambiguous. contentBytes: First(att_SubmitContract_AttachFile.Attachments).Value, I also tried omitting the file extension from the name. Please see https://aka.ms/logicexpressions for usage details I have the same question as David; from the explanation its clear that contentBytes: refers the buttons on select to a specific attached file and the name: gives that file a name. A file must be passed as an object to Power Automate. The following concepts are shown: Connecting to the data Displaying metadata about the document Displaying thumbnail pictures for the author and the person who last modified the document Displaying thumbnails of the documents Launching the documents in separate browser tabs to view and edit them Delete the form. contentBytes: First(att_Year2LearningLead-ImpactLog_AttachFile.Attachments).Value, A great place where you can stay up to date with community calls and interact with the speakers. Click here
Sometimes Power Apps does not recognize any changes until we do this. name: First(att_SubmitContract_AttachFile.Attachments).Name Notify the owner whenever a document is modified Related functions include the Update function to replace an entire record, and the Collect function to create a record. We're already working on setting up your trial. select PDF viewer. If I change code to the following, I can reduce errors to just the invalid number of arguments, 4 vs 1: UploadFileToDocumentLibrary.Run( Patch ( SPDocLib, LookUp (SPDocLib,Name = "example_photo.jpg"), {groupID:varRecord.ID} ) I could amend my Flow to update this column, or return the ID as a second output to PowerApps and use that to patch, but wondered if anyone knows of a limitation working with patch on a document library in this way? Make both fields required. Thanks for the compliment, Im glad you got it working . Therefore, lookup will always find the first row in [dbo]. That said, how can we configure this code block to apply to the file dropped in the attachments box? Do you have a screenshot of the syntax error message you are receiving? I've got an app that links to a SP library as a data source ( I want a library rather than a list as I have a populate word document flow linked to the library that I want to keep). Unit_Dropdown.Selected.Value, (OrderID = A[@OrderID]) is expected to compare the OrderId in the lookup scope with the OrderId of collection A in the ForAll scope. Would appreciate anyone being able to have a look at the below and see if there's anything glaring that I've missed? I had to peek code and enter it manually within required: [ file]. Will try this tonight. I was just curious about one pointYou describe the Content Type to be passed to Power Automate as follows, but doesnt this cause the flow to fail because the Outputs in Power Automate do not include the body? To continue with "{{emailaddress}}", please follow these
This is the likely cause of your apps issue. One method is to pass only the unique identifier from a complex column as a text field and get the full object from inside flow. Function Text has invalid arguments. In the OnSelect property of the print control type the formula Print (). Patch a SharePoint document library using Name to GCC, GCCH, DoD - Federal App Makers (FAM). Maybe the order of the arguments needs to be different-based on how your setup the flow trigger? { For example, this formula creates a record for a customer named Contoso: Patch( Customers, Defaults( Customers ), { Name: "Contoso" } ). Time to look at the "recipe"" for this PowerApps Cookbook entry: RECIPE:. I've been working in the information technology industry for over 30 years, and have played key roles in several enterprise SharePoint architectural design review, Intranet deployment, application development, and migration projects. did you managed to get it working now bro because i am having the same issue. }, txt_SubmitContract_CustomerName.Text, However, when using your workaround in PowerApps, it causes the Automate flow to send as many emails as there are documents. The ID will be the ID from the Update File Properties action and the File Identifier is the ID from the Get Attachments Action. name: First(att_SubmitContract_AttachFile.Attachments).Name You can't yield a full name in this case. Power Apps Easiest Way To Upload Files To A SharePoint Document Library; All Power Apps Date & Time Functions (With Examples) 7 Ways To Use The PATCH Function In Power Apps (Cheat Sheet) PowerApps Collections Cookbook; Easiest Way To Generate A PDF In Power Apps (No HTML) 2,000 Free Power Apps Icons In contrast, the UpdateIf and the Patch functions modify one or . Go back to your form that is connected to your SharePoint document library and paste the attachment control. Unable to process template language expressions in action Create_file inputs at line 1 and column 12241: The template language expression triggerBody()[file][name] cannot be evaluated because property name doesnt exist, available properties are . To learn more about the usage of As operator and ThisRecord see Operators article. Enter your email to start your free trial. Please try again later. The trigger input field is set to required. Please check the following screenshot: So on your side, please consider modify your formula as below: Please consider take a try with above solution, check if the issue is solved. Find the control that has the paperclip icon and right-click and Copy the control. The contract document should appear in your SharePoint site as shown below. 2021. . Directorate_Dropdown.Selected.Value, UploadFileToDocumentLibrary.Run( txt_SubmitContract_ClientType.Text One of the newly released features of PowerApps is the ability to add attachments to a SharePoint list item. txt_SubmitContract_ClientType.Text Attach some different types of files using the Attach file option. }, Matthew, thanks! Keep up to date with current events and community announcements in the Power Apps community. Alternatively, you can use ThisRecord for the same purpose. contentBytes: First(att_SubmitContract_AttachFile.Attachments).Value, You can find me on LinkedIn: https://linkedin.com/in/manueltgomes and twitter http://twitter.com/manueltgomes. Merges two records outside of a data source: {Name:"Jim", Score:90, Passed:true}, To modify a record, the base record needs to have come from a data source. For the File Identifier property you'll select the ID from the "Get Attachments" action. I need the PowerApp to change the value of this field from "Apple" to "Orange". Please re-read the section of my article titled Add Metadata To A SharePoint Document Library and look at the 2nd paragraph. This is really helpful! Documents cannot be uploaded to a SharePoint document library directly from Power Apps. Then add another action at the bottom of the flow: SharePoint Update file properties, Now we are done updating the Flow. Go to the Action tab -> Power Automate -> Click on + Create a new flow as like below. If we wanted to include the ability to upload multiple files at the same time we could change the OnSelect property of the upload button to loop through each attachment and run the flow once per file. You may already know how to work with SharePoint lists but document libraries present new challenges. Id also like to be able to add metadata at the upload stage but going one step further Id like it to be managed metadata (i.e. To do this, we will add the "SharePoint - Delete Attachments" action. Just to add to Davids comment, you can use the Peek Code to check if they are required or not. Power Platform and Dynamics 365 Integrations. .Collections are usually considered a structural component of a. Yes, the code will work with dropdowns/comboboxes so long as the output is text. Text( First(
Left, Right And Straight In Spanish,
Del Norte High School Football,
Articles P
powerapps patch document library